Fayemi joins APC presidential race, unfolds agenda

Ekiti State Governor and Chairman, Nigeria Governors’ Forum, Kayode Fayemi will formally declare his intention to run for the position of President of the country on Wednesday in Abuja. His Chief Press Secretary, Yinka Oyebode, made this known in a statement issued to journalists on Tuesday. According to him, Wednesday’s declaration, tagged, ‘Unveiling My Nigeria Agenda’, would lay to rest speculations on whether Fayemi would run for the Presidency or not. Oyebode said his principal had discussed his plan to run for the number one office with the President, Major General Muhammadu Buhari (retd), traditional rulers and political leaders across states in the Federation. The statement was titled, ‘2023: Fayemi Joins Presidential Race, Unfolds Agenda After Nationwide Consultations With Leaders’.
